Engaging and Immersive Learning

Traditional teaching methods can sometimes fall short in capturing the attention and interest of students. 3D printing offers a captivating and immersive learning experience that breaks down barriers and sparks curiosity. When students witness their ideas transformed into tangible objects, they become active participants in the learning process, leading to increased motivation and engagement.

With 3D printing, abstract concepts take on a concrete form, making complex subjects more accessible and relatable. For example, in biology class, students can print anatomical models, providing a hands-on understanding of human organs and systems. In history lessons, they can bring historical artifacts to life by creating accurate replicas. This approach not only enhances comprehension but also encourages students to delve deeper into the subjects they are studying.

Encouraging Creativity and Design Thinking

Creativity is a vital skill in the 21st century, and 3D printing provides an ideal platform for students to unleash their imaginative potential. By allowing them to design and fabricate objects from scratch, 3D printing nurtures the spirit of innovation and design thinking.

In art and design classes, students can explore their artistic flair by creating sculptures and functional art pieces. In engineering and technology subjects, they can design and prototype solutions to real-world problems, promoting critical thinking and problem-solving skills.

Moreover, 3D printing empowers students to iterate and refine their designs, fostering a growth mindset where failures are seen as stepping stones to success. The iterative process teaches resilience and perseverance, essential attributes in both academics and life.

Integrating STEM Learning Seamlessly

STEM education is a cornerstone of modern learning, preparing students for careers in fields that drive innovation and economic growth. 3D printing naturally aligns with STEM learning, providing a hands-on approach to mastering complex concepts and reinforcing theoretical knowledge.

In science classes, students can create 3D models of molecular structures, celestial bodies, or geological formations, enhancing their understanding of scientific principles. In mathematics, they can visualize geometric shapes, solidify concepts of volume and surface area, and even explore fractals.

Furthermore, 3D printing stimulates an interest in engineering and technology, encouraging students to pursue careers in these fields. By exposing students to cutting-edge technologies, we nurture the future innovators and problem solvers that our society needs.

Fostering Collaboration and Interdisciplinary Learning

3D printing projects often require teamwork and collaboration. As students work together to bring their ideas to life, they learn valuable interpersonal skills, such as communication, negotiation, and cooperation. Collaborative projects also promote a sense of camaraderie and create a positive learning environment within the classroom.

Moreover, 3D printing offers a unique opportunity for interdisciplinary learning. Students can explore connections between different subjects by integrating elements of science, art, history, and technology into their projects. This interdisciplinary approach enhances the depth and richness of their learning experience, encouraging a holistic understanding of the world.
